Overview of Brookdale North Mesa

Welcoming residents and guests warmly, Brookdale North Mesa settling at East Brown Road, Mesa, AZ, is an idyllic senior living community providing assisted living and memory care. The community features diverse floor plans including an alcove studio, a large studio suite, and a one-bedroom suite. Brookdale North Mesa prioritizes the independence and growth of seniors, conversing with them and their loved ones to deliver the utmost care and assistance they deserve.

Brookdale North Mesa promotes a vibrant community, encouraging residents to remain active and connected with others. Assisted living residents enjoy all-day dining with freshly prepared healthy meals while memory care residents experience meals like a routine to ensure everyone’s comfort. The pet-friendly community includes a library, a beauty and barber shop, an arts and crafts studio, a community kitchen, a game room, meeting rooms, a piano, beautifully landscaped grounds, and walking paths for the seniors’ enjoyment and wellness.

Inspection Reports Summary Info An editor-reviewed summary of the themes and findings across this facility's recent inspection reports.

This facility’s inspection record is mixed, with recent citations focused on service plans and medication errors but no immediate jeopardy or fines. On July 16, 2025, inspectors found three deficiencies related to incomplete service plans and medication administration failures, while a November 5, 2025 off-site review cited no deficiencies. The December 20, 2022 annual inspection flagged 14 deficiencies across documentation, equipment maintenance, and food safety, indicating ongoing challenges in compliance.

Arizona Long Term Care System

ALTCS

Age 65+ or disabled
General Arizona resident, Medicaid-eligible, nursing home-level care need.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,829/month 300% FBR, individual
Asset Limits $2,000 (individual), $3,000 (couple).
AZ

Covers tribal members; rural outreach.

Benefits
In-home care (6-8 hours/day) Assisted living Nursing home care Medical services Transportation (10 trips/month)
